About Priyanka Sista

Priyanka Sista is a scholar working on Family Practice,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ty and Geriatrics and Gerontology, having authored 12 papers that have together received 992 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Meta-analysis and systematic reviews (4 papers), Medication Adherence and Compliance (3 papers), Patient Dignity and Privacy (2 papers), Health Systems, Economic Evaluations, Quality of Life (2 papers), Innovations in Medical Education (2 papers), Pharmaceutical industry and healthcare (2 papers), Health and Medical Research Impacts (2 papers) and Pharmaceutical Practices and Patient Outcomes (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Family Practice (354 citations), Geriatrics and Gerontology (191 citations) and Applied Psychology (48 citations). Priyanka Sista has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Austria and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Kathleen N Lohr, Meera Viswanathan, Christine D. Jones, Carol E. Golin, Roberta Wines, David L. Rosen, Susan J. Blalock, Mahima Ashok, Emmanuel Coker‐Schwimmer and Melissa L McPheeters. Their work appears in journals such as Western Journal of Emergency Medicine, Annals of Internal Medicine, Journal of Clinical Epidemiology, AEM Education and Training and Journal of Palliative Medicine.
